Slot Number
12942040
Finalized
Epoch Number
Status
proposed
Age
86 days 8 hrs ago (Nov-03-2025 12:08:23 AM +UTC)

BlockRoot Hash
0x66d8c3828e16757647f6c10e5084de6dada62dbd6e2a8c7785e35bc0c2cb5f5d
State Root
0xc053ad45b2421621c79477462cf9260963d04e1fff3084dce630bfa71de88931

Randao Reveal
0xa6267c0849d13501275eb7554db9c4b8683b5522e9e488f9f85aa4cfbd37553df33552e9a4684117734e6c070ad966a302ef735341104a10ef053aa647a921903f48e21dcf0abcd6482641e31514e8598e28deae74c2a861dc59d352e2ac20dd

Graffiti
(Hex:0x7373762e6e6574776f726b000000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xa932db283af5c3f1515b41e4c044dba4a7619041b7072e6a99c6c72d1813433c87b03a0ba6a19af45e874268df7cda9c0cecafba34d50c7a374abb9752cda5d1c206fc5139c60462a905dc73a29e719bedcc3662d0769926b72a5916763b8f2f

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ators